Ambassador Sheikh Dr. Ahmed Nasser Mohammad A. Al Sabah, Assistant Foreign Minister for the Cabinet of the Deputy Prime Minister & Minister of Foreign Affairs signing the Condolence Book at the Embassy today.

A book of condolence for former Indian Minister of External Affairs Smt Sushma Swaraj, who passed away on 6 August after a heart attack, has been opened at the Embassy of India, Kuwait.

Acting Deputy Foreign Minister Ambassador Sheikh Dr. Ahmad Nasser Al-Sabah Thursday paid his respects to the former Indian foreign minister, commending her contributions to further promoting and developing relations and cooperation between Kuwait and India.

Sheikh Ahmad added that the late minister Swaraj played a leading role at the regional and international levels. The condolence book is open from Wednesday, 7 August until Friday, 10 August from 10 am to 1 pm and 2 pm to 5 pm.
